As an Early Intervention Specialist, you will play a vital role in supporting the development of infants and toddlers with special needs, working closely with their families to create a nurturing environment that fosters growth and progress.
Key Responsibilities:- Conduct weekly home visits with children aged 0-3 and their families, providing individualized support and guidance to promote healthy development.
- Administer standardized assessments, such as the Batelle (BDI-2) and Bayley-4, to identify areas of strength and need.
- Develop and implement individualized goals and strategies to support the child's development, working collaboratively with parents and caregivers.
- Provide ongoing coaching and support to parents and caregivers, empowering them to create a supportive and stimulating environment for their child.
- Engage with children and families in a positive and respectful manner, fostering strong relationships and promoting a sense of community.
- Bachelor's Degree in Early Childhood Development, Special Education, or a closely related field.
- At least 2 years of experience working with infants and toddlers with special needs, with a strong understanding of child development and the importance of the parent-child relationship.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with diverse populations.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team, with a strong commitment to collaboration and mutual support.
- Bilingual in Spanish is a plus, but not required.
